Project served me well for a long time to convert my feeds into readable and searchable list of channels. Bot is public and can be used by everyone, not only you. It does scrape scheduling taking into account feed activity -- inactive feeds are polled once an hour, while active ones can be polled faster based on amount of items posted around same time for last week. Supports ATOM/RSS feeds, custom IV for links, link editing (to use shorter links if website uses full links in RSS feeds).
